Lots of Slate coloured Juncos enjoying the fallen hyssop seeds from my fall 
garden clean up.  The family of Trumpeter Swans from Ken Reid Park in Lindsay 
are just off one of my neighbour’s dock on Sturgeon lake, hoping for a handout. 
 Also, a glimpse of what appeared to be either a pair of Purple Finches or 
Common Red Poles, as they briefly landed on the back of one of my deck chairs.

Judy Kennedy,
Southview Estates, Cameron Ontario.

Directions to Southview Estates.  Hwy 35 north from Lindsay to the village of 
Cameron.  Turn right on Longbeach Road and drive east for 2 KM to the first big 
bend.  Turn right on Anderson Drive, proceed past the farm house and barn to 
either Victoria Drive or Beehive Drive, which connect at the ends of the 
streets, for a drive around.  Most of the houses on Victoria Dive back onto 
Beehive, so birding is good from either street.  There is  public road access 
to the shoreline at the end of Anderson Drive for waterfront viewing.
